Output 62312861825ec30c4e9136735a680355d068f3666ccd8e7ff911703d061dcfa2:3

value
15731738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4ddd1993a9e0a8389b346ecc3ef8db437bf22c OP_EQUAL
address
MDDShcrtQYSNHC1sWYnCHUaneiRhDLZ4a9
transaction
62312861825ec30c4e9136735a680355d068f3666ccd8e7ff911703d061dcfa2
spent
true